What Makes a Winter Coat Truly Warm
Warmth in a men's winter coat depends on three things: insulation type, fill power or weight, and how well the coat traps heat without becoming bulky. A coat that works in dry cold will fail in wet cold, and a lightweight packable jacket will leave you shivering in a Minnesota January. The best warm winter coats for men balance insulation, weather protection, and breathability so you stay comfortable without overheating or sweating through layers.

Before comparing specific styles, it helps to understand the insulation options that drive most of the warmth decisions you will make.
Down vs Synthetic vs Wool: Insulation Trade-Offs
Each insulation type has a clear comfort zone, and choosing the right one matters more than brand name or outer fabric.
- Down: High fill-power down (650 to 900 fill) offers the best warmth-to-weight ratio. It compresses small, lasts years with care, and feels luxurious. The downside is that down loses insulation when wet and takes a long time to dry.
- Synthetic insulation: Polyester fills like PrimaLoft, Thermore, and Climashield mimic down's loft but retain warmth when damp. They dry faster and are often cheaper, though they are heavier and less compressible.
- Wool and wool blends: Natural wool regulates temperature well, resists odors, and handles dampness better than down. Pure wool coats are heavy and bulky, so most warm winter styles use wool blended with synthetic fibers or layered over an insulating midlayer.
If you face damp, variable winters, synthetic or a high-quality wool blend often outperforms a pure down coat. If you face dry, extreme cold, high-fill-power down is hard to beat.
Coat Categories Compared
The table below compares the main categories of warm men's winter coats, focusing on the warmth-versus-practicality trade-offs.
| Category | Warmth Range | Best For | Key Trade-Off |
|---|---|---|---|
| High-fill down parka | Extreme cold, -20°F and below | Dry cold climates, outdoor work | Heavy when fully loaded; poor in wet conditions |
| Mid-weight down jacket | Moderate to cold, 15°F to 30°F | Everyday urban wear, commuting | Less warmth than a parka; needs a midlayer |
| Synthetic insulated jacket | Cold to moderate, 20°F to 40°F | Wet or variable climates, active use | Heavier and less compressible than down |
| Wool overcoat with thermal lining | Moderate cold, 25°F to 40°F | Formal or smart-casual settings | Bulky; relies on layers for true extreme cold |
| Insulated soft-shell | Cold, 10°F to 30°F | Active commuting, layering system | Wind-resistant, not fully waterproof |
Down Parkas: The Gold Standard for Extreme Cold
A well-made down parka is the most effective single garment for staying warm in harsh winter conditions. Look for fill powers of 700 or higher, a generous fill weight (typically 150 grams or more), and a windproof, water-resistant shell. Longer lengths that hit mid-thigh or below protect the core and kidneys, which matters when temperatures drop. Features like two-way zippers, helmet-compatible hoods, and pit zips for ventilation add real-world usability.
The trade-off is bulk. Many high-performance parkas are too large to wear casually under a desk chair or on a crowded bus. If you need a coat that transitions from a trailhead to a restaurant, a mid-weight down jacket with a trim cut often makes more sense than a full expedition parka.
Synthetic Coats: Reliable in Wet and Variable Winters
For the Pacific Northwest, the Northeast, or any climate where rain or sleet mixes with cold, synthetic insulation is often the smarter choice. Modern synthetic fills retain about 80 to 90 percent of their insulating ability when wet and dry in a fraction of the time down needs. Brands such as Patagonia, Arc'teryx, and Uniqlo offer synthetic options across a wide price range, from lightweight everyday jackets to heavy-duty expedition models.
The main downside is bulk. A synthetic coat that matches the warmth of a 700-fill down jacket will usually be heavier and thicker. If you live in a dry cold zone, you are carrying unnecessary weight for the same thermal performance.
Wool Overcoats: Warmth With Style
Wool overcoats occupy the space where warmth meets appearance. A thick Melton wool coat with a thermal lining can handle moderate winter days without looking like a puffy parka. They work well with suits and dress pants, and they resist odor far better than synthetic fills, which means you can wear them for days between washes.
For genuinely cold days, a wool overcoat needs help. A down or synthetic vest underneath, a warm scarf, and insulated boots close the gap. The best warm winter coats for men in this category pair a quality wool exterior with a removable or integrated thermal liner so you can adjust to changing temperatures.
Fit, Layering, and Sizing Considerations
No coat performs well if it does not fit correctly. A coat that is too tight compresses the insulation and reduces its warmth. A coat that is too loose lets cold air circulate and does not trap body heat effectively. When trying on, wear the midlayer you plan to use most often. You should be able to move your arms freely, fasten the front without strain, and overlap the hem over your hips.
Consider your layering strategy before you buy. A coat sized for a single sweater underneath will feel wrong when you add a fleece and a base layer on the coldest days. Some brands size their parkas specifically to accommodate a heavy midlayer; check fit guides and user reviews before ordering.
Care and Longevity
A quality winter coat should last five to ten years with proper care. Down coats need regular fluffing to maintain loft and should be washed infrequently with specialized detergents. Synthetic insulation tolerates more frequent washing and is less fussy, but it can lose loft over time if stored compressed for long periods. Wool overcoats benefit from annual brushing and professional cleaning when needed.
Storing coats on wide, padded hangers rather than cramming them into closets helps preserve shape and insulation. In humid climates, a dehumidified closet or a breathable garment bag prevents mildew, which degrades both down and wool.
Price and Value Expectations
Warm winter coats span a wide price range. Entry-level synthetic jackets can be found for under $150 and still offer solid everyday warmth. Mid-range down jackets in the $250 to $400 range typically offer the best balance of performance and durability for most men. High-end expedition parkas and premium wool overcoats can run $500 to $1,000 or more, with improvements in materials, construction, and warranty that matter most in extreme conditions or heavy daily use.
The best warm winter coats for men are not always the most expensive ones. Match the coat to your actual climate, your layering habits, and the activities you will wear it for, and you will get more warmth per dollar than chasing brand prestige alone.
